Anyone can add themselves to the following mailing lists:
- dev. Unless you are accepted as a CVS developer as
- described in the DEVEL-CVS file, you will only be able to
- read this list, not send to it. The charter of the list is
- also in DEVEL-CVS.
- cvs. The only messages sent to this list are sent
+ cvs-announce: CVS release announcements and other major
+ announcements about the project are sent to this list.
+ cvs-announce-binaries: Announcements are made to this list
+ when binaries for various platforms are built and initially
+ posted for download.
+ cvs-cvs: The only messages sent to this list are sent
automatically, via the CVS `loginfo' mechanism, when someone
checks something in to the master CVS repository.
- test-results. The only messages sent to this list are sent
+ cvs-test-results: The only messages sent to this list are sent
automatically, daily, by a script which runs "make check"
and "make remotecheck" on the master CVS sources.
-To subscribe to dev, cvs, or test-results, send
-a message to "<list>address@hidden" or visit
-http://ccvs.cvshome.org/servlets/ProjectMailingListList and follow the
-instructions there.
+To subscribe to cvs-announce, cvs-announce-binaries, cvs-cvs,
+or test-results, visit https://savannah.nongnu.org/mail/?group=cvs
+and follow the instructions for the list you wish to subscribe to.
